STEAK AND SPINACH SALAD



Steak and Spinach Salad image

The perfect main course for salad lovers. This salad uses fresh spinach instead of lettuce.

Provided by Rena

Categories     Salad     Green Salad Recipes     Spinach Salad Recipes

Time 15m

Yield 2

Number Of Ingredients 7

6 cups fresh spinach, rinsed and dried
½ cup dried cranberries
½ cup walnut halves
1 tomato, sliced
1 pound top round steak, thinly sliced
1 pinch salt
1 pinch ground black pepper

Steps:

  • Arrange spinach on a large plate. Sprinkle with cranberries and walnuts, and arrange tomato slices on top. Set aside.
  • In a non-stick skillet (or a regular skillet coated with non-stick spray) cook steak over medium heat until no pink remains and steak is thoroughly cooked.
  • Arrange cooked steak over salad. Sprinkle salt and pepper on top, and drizzle with your favorite dressing. Note: I suggest using a light flavored dressing. Citrus dressings taste especially good on this salad!

RASPBERRY SPINACH SALAD WITH GARLIC STEAK



Raspberry Spinach Salad With Garlic Steak image

I put this recipe together as my own variation on a classic. It became an instant hit with the whole family, and has been requested for our regular rotation. Prep time does not include marinating time.

Provided by Sugarmagnolia_fl

Categories     Raspberries

Time 23m

Yield 3 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 16

1 large garlic clove, minced
1 tablespoon minced onion (dried or fresh)
2 teaspoons coarse black pepper
1 tablespoon kosher salt (or other coarse salt)
1 tablespoon fresh thyme leave
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 1/3 lbs top sirloin steaks
1/2 cup raspberry balsamic vinegar
1 pint fresh raspberry, divided
1/4 cup honey
1/3 cup sugar
2 tablespoons fresh oregano leaves (or 1/2 cup fresh basil leaves)
3/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
6 ounces fresh Baby Spinach
1/3 cup walnuts, chopped
1/2 cup gorgonzola, crumbled

Steps:

  • Preheat grill or broiler.
  • In a small bowl, mix together the pepper, garlic, onion, salt and thyme. Rub olive oil all over the meat. Rub seasoning mixture all over the meat. Place in a shallow dish and marinate at room temperature for about an hour, or while preparing the remaining salad and vinaigrette. (Can also cover and marinade in the fridge for up to 2 days. Remove meat from fridge an hour before grilling).
  • Put walnuts in a small pan over med-low heat. Let toast until you can smell them (while you are preparing the remaining recipe).
  • In a blender or food processor, combine raspberry vinegar, 1/4 cup raspberries, honey, and oregano (or basil); whirl 1 minutes or until well blended. With the motor on, add olive oil in a slow steady stream, whirling until dressing is smooth.
  • Grill steak about 3-4 minutes per side or until done to your preference. (Using a meat thermometer - Rare: 120F; Medium Rare: 125F; Medium: 130F).
  • When the steaks are done to your liking, remove from oven, let sit 15 minutes before serving (meat temperature will rise 5 to 10 degrees after it is removed from the oven). Slice steak across grain into 1/4-inch slices.
  • While steaks are resting, prepare salad by layering equally on each plate the spinach, remaining raspberries, walnuts and cheese. Place strips of steak on top of each salad. Serve dressing on the side.

STRAWBERRY SPINACH SALAD WITH RASPBERRY DRESSING



Strawberry Spinach Salad with Raspberry Dressing image

Berries add a pop of color to this favorite salad that's part of my gluten-free menu. My challenge is to keep the family from eating the sugared almonds before I add them! -Peggy Gwillim, Strasbourg, Saskatchewan -Peggy Gwillim, Strasbourg, Saskatchewan

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ch     Side Dishes

Time 20m

Yield 10 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 13

1/4 cup slivered almonds
2 tablespoons sugar
1 package (10 ounces) fresh spinach, torn
1 cup fresh strawberries, sliced
DRESSING:
2 tablespoons canola oil
1 tablespoon raspberry vinegar
1 green onion, finely chopped
1-1/2 teaspoons sugar
1-1/2 teaspoons gluten-free Worcestershire sauce
1 teaspoon poppy seeds
1/4 teaspoon salt
Dash paprika

Steps:

  • In a large skillet, cook and stir almonds and sugar over low heat until sugar is dissolved and almonds are coated. Spread on foil to cool; break apart., In a large salad bowl, combine the spinach, strawberries and almonds. In a jar with a tight-fitting lid, combine the dressing ingredients; shake well. Drizzle over salad; toss gently to coat. Serve immediately.

SPINACH, RASPBERRY, AND TOASTED PECAN SALAD



Spinach, Raspberry, and Toasted Pecan Salad image

This is a great spinach salad for all occasions. It was such a hit with my family and friends, I have been asked to write it down time and time again. So now I'm posting it on here to save my wrist from all that writing!

Provided by Melanie2590

Categories     Salad Dressings

Time 13m

Yield 8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

6 ounces Baby Spinach
1 whole avocado, chopped
5 -6 green onions, finely chopped
1 cup fresh raspberry
1/2 cup chopped pecans
3 tablespoons raspberry preserves
1 teaspoon balsamic vinegar
1 tablespoon red wine vinegar
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
1/2 cup extra virgin olive oil

Steps:

  • Place pecans on baking sheet and toast in oven at 400 degrees for about 5 minutes.
  • Mix together dressing ingredients in small glass or bowl and wisk quickly until well blended.
  • Layer salad: spinach, avocado, green onions, raspberries, toasted pecans.
  • Top with dressing and serve immediately.
